Bug 618398

Summary: update to latest version
Product: [Fedora] Fedora Reporter: Jiri Moskovcak <jmoskovc>
Component: xfce4-notifydAssignee: Christoph Wickert <christoph.wickert>
Status: CLOSED RAWHIDE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: low    
Version: 14CC: christoph.wickert, dfediuck, johannes.lips
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2010-11-27 16:46:21 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
regenerated dbus name patch
none
build fixes none

Description Jiri Moskovcak 2010-07-26 20:28:35 UTC
Please update to the latest version of the xfce4-notifyd, it has some great improvements against the old version which is in Fedora (like smart placement, progressbar support, etc ...) Adding a patch that is required to compile the latest git on F13 and regenerated dbus-name patch.

Jirka

Comment 1 Jiri Moskovcak 2010-07-26 20:29:44 UTC
Created attachment 434523 [details]
regenerated dbus name patch

Comment 2 Jiri Moskovcak 2010-07-26 20:30:33 UTC
Created attachment 434524 [details]
build fixes

Comment 3 Christoph Wickert 2010-07-26 20:59:25 UTC
Thanks, I missed the new release because it wasn't announced on the Xfce mailing list.

Comment 4 Christoph Wickert 2010-07-26 21:10:08 UTC
Where did you find the source of 0.2.0? I cannot find it at 
http://spuriousinterrupt.org/files/ or
http://archive.xfce.org/src/apps/xfce4-notifyd/

Comment 5 Jiri Moskovcak 2010-07-27 09:22:37 UTC
I found just announcement here: http://spuriousinterrupt.org/projects/xfce4-notifyd saying:

"""
The current version of xfce4-notifyd is 0.2.0, released on 15 April 2010.

Source: .tar.bz2 (SHA1 sum, PGP signature)
"""

but the download link is broken, so I compiled the latest git.

J.

Comment 6 Christoph Wickert 2010-07-27 09:39:57 UTC
Meanwhile I contacted Brian, let's see what he replies. If there is no source tarball available, I will use GIT.

Comment 7 Bug Zapper 2010-07-30 12:51:43 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 14 development cycle.
Changing version to '14'.

More information and reason for this action is here:
http://fedoraproject.org/wiki/BugZappers/HouseKeeping

Comment 8 hannes 2010-10-13 17:21:17 UTC
Hey,

as promised I worked on it...
I took the latest git source but am totally unsure if I did this right, regarding versioning etc..
I removed all patches because it just built fine without them but perhaps there is another reason that they should be applied. 

SRPM URL: http://hannes.fedorapeople.org/xfce4-notifyd-0.2.0-0.2.20100826git.fc14.src.rpm
SPEC URL: http://hannes.fedorapeople.org/xfce4-notifyd.spec

I hope this helps as a little appetizer I add a screenshot of the new xfce4-notifyd in action... ;)
http://hannes.fedorapeople.org/Screenshot%20-%2010132010%20-%2002:43:25%20PM.png

Comment 9 Christoph Wickert 2010-11-27 16:46:21 UTC
Finally 0.2.0 was released today. I built it for rawhide, you also want me to push it to F14? Is there anything wrong with the 0.1.0 package that justifies an update?

Comment 10 Christoph Wickert 2010-11-27 17:19:35 UTC
One thing I don't like is the fact that the new version requires libxfce4ui instead of libxfcehui4. Basically it is targeted at Xfce 4.8.

Comment 11 hannes 2010-11-27 18:12:20 UTC
I don't know if there are any known bugs which are closed by this update. But for me the new functionality which could be seen in previous screenshot is one big plus for pushing it into fedora 14. I mean all the dependencies are there and I don't think that this is such a critical package. 
I would go for pushing it because I don't really see any drawback of an update despite the fact that it is an "major" version update which should be avoided with the new update policy.

Comment 12 Christoph Wickert 2010-11-27 21:16:55 UTC
There was indeed a problem with the 0.1.0, see bug 657781.

Comment 13 Christoph Wickert 2010-11-28 11:15:07 UTC
Not sure if I'm going to push 0.2.0 to F14, ATM we are thinking of backporting 0.2.0 to libxfcegui4 and call it 0.1.5. I really dislike the idea of having libxfce4ui in F14/Xfce 4.6.

Comment 14 Jiri Moskovcak 2010-11-28 12:36:26 UTC
The reasons I wanted this update are:
1. overlapping notifications when there are multiple notifications shown at the same time
2. the notifications are shown at wrong positions when using multiple monitors..

at least this would be nice to have fixed in F14, I think we can wait for the eycandy from 0.2.0 to F15 :)